>>From the Debian Policy manual:
> 2.5
> Packages must not depend on packages with lower priority values
> (excluding build-time dependencies). In order to ensure this, the
> priorities of one or more packages may need to be adjusted.
>
> openssh-server has Priority: optional
> openssh-blacklist has Priority: extra
openssh-blacklist has the wrong priority and should be priority: optional.
This problem is significant enough that the need for this package is not
an unusual or edge case. I'll file a bug against openssh-blacklist asking
that it be increased.
